Unusual Noises or Vibrations

One of the clearest signs you may need professional auto repair in Bloomington, MN is hearing unusual noises or feeling vibrations while driving. Grinding brakes, squealing belts, knocking sounds from the engine, or vibrations in the steering wheel often point to mechanical issues that require immediate attention. These sounds rarely fix themselves and usually worsen over time. Leaks, Odors, or Difficulty Starting

Leaks under your car, burning smells, or trouble starting the engine are serious signs that professional auto repair in Bloomington, MN should not be delayed. Fluid leaks can involve oil, coolant, transmission fluid, or brake fluid, all of which are critical to vehicle safety and operation. Unusual odors may signal overheating or electrical problems.
